Sat 1381884029391228

decimal
342753.1529391228
degree
0°132753′33″1529391228‴
percentile
65.80400147196673%
name
ebftymnrxpd
cycle
0
epoch
1
period
170
block
342753
offset
1529391228
timestamp
rarity
common